How do I repair my relationship with exercise?

1. Start small. Don't try to do too much too soon. Start with something manageable and gradually increase the intensity and duration of your workouts.

2. Find an activity you enjoy. Exercise doesn't have to be a chore. Find something you enjoy doing and make it part of your routine.

3. Set realistic goals. Don't set yourself up for failure by setting unrealistic goals. Set achievable goals and reward yourself when you reach them.

4. Make it a habit. Make exercise a part of your daily routine. Schedule it in and make it a priority.

5. Get support. Find a friend or family member who can help motivate you and keep you accountable.

6. Track your progress. Keep track of your progress and celebrate your successes. This will help keep you motivated and on track.

7. Take breaks. Don't push yourself too hard. Take breaks when you need them and don't be afraid to take a day off if you need it.

8. Be kind to yourself. Don't be too hard on yourself if you don't reach your goals. Remember that progress takes time and be patient with yourself.
